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/apache-kafka/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Apache kafka 我们可以让healthcheck Rest API从卡夫卡公开吗?_Apache Kafka_Monitoring - Fatal编程技术网

Apache kafka 我们可以让healthcheck Rest API从卡夫卡公开吗?

Apache kafka 我们可以让healthcheck Rest API从卡夫卡公开吗?,apache-kafka,monitoring,Apache Kafka,Monitoring,我想知道我们是否可以从卡夫卡公开一些RESTAPI,这些API可以用于健康检查或其他类似的事情 如果没有找到任何提供相关信息的博客。卡夫卡不提供REST API,但Confluent已经开发了一个从卡夫卡生产/消费的应用程序。但是,它不提供健康检查信息 这取决于你所说的healthcheck是什么意思,但从Linkedin获得集群的端到端视图非常好 Kafka不提供REST API,但Confluent开发了一个从Kafka生产/消费的API。但是,它不提供健康检查信息 这取决于你所说的heal

我想知道我们是否可以从卡夫卡公开一些RESTAPI,这些API可以用于健康检查或其他类似的事情


如果没有找到任何提供相关信息的博客。

卡夫卡不提供REST API,但Confluent已经开发了一个从卡夫卡生产/消费的应用程序。但是,它不提供健康检查信息


这取决于你所说的healthcheck是什么意思,但从Linkedin获得集群的端到端视图非常好

Kafka不提供REST API,但Confluent开发了一个从Kafka生产/消费的API。但是,它不提供健康检查信息


这取决于你所说的healthcheck是什么意思,但从Linkedin获得集群的端到端视图非常好

如果您只需要REST API进行健康检查,那么下面的存储库可能就是您所需要的:

如果您只需要REST API进行健康检查,那么下面的存储库可能就是您所需要的:

您可以添加JMX代理,如Jolokia或Prometheus JMX exporters,它们通过HTTP公开所有JMX数据

例如,从那里,您可以将数据收集到Prometheus服务器中,并关联定义不健康集群的内容,例如URP或高堆使用率等

非HTTP/拉式解决方案也存在,如Telegraf或Datadog


Confluent提供了Control Center,它可能通过API暴露某种级别的集群运行状况。您可以添加JMX代理,如Jolokia或Prometheus JMX exporters,它们通过HTTP公开所有JMX数据

例如,从那里,您可以将数据收集到Prometheus服务器中,并关联定义不健康集群的内容,例如URP或高堆使用率等

非HTTP/拉式解决方案也存在,如Telegraf或Datadog


Confluent提供了Control Center,它可能会从API中暴露某种级别的群集运行状况

上次我检查时,Kafka没有任何rest端点。它只用于schema注册表。我相信即使现在也是这样。上次我检查时,卡夫卡没有任何休息终点。它只用于schema注册表。我相信即使现在也是这样。